About the BDA
We are the voice of dentists and dental students in the UK. We bring dentists together, support our members through advice and education, and represent their interests. This is a challenging and dynamic period for dentistry and the BDA is recruiting another Dento-legal Adviser to join our Indemnity team.
About the role
This is a part-time permanent post working three days a week. We anticipate a hybrid approach to working location, with home working alongside attendance at our central London office as and when required.
In response to the increased number of dentists joining BDA Indemnity, we are expanding our team based in London and this is an exciting and unique opportunity to join our team of experienced Dento-legal Advisers.
About you
This role would ideally suit a dentist who has a Dento-legal qualification and experience assisting colleagues with complaints, claims and regulatory investigations.
